目錄
使用 Python 將圖片轉換為灰階
在影像處理中,將圖片轉換為灰階是一個常見的操作,它可以用於減少圖片的複雜度,並提高處理速度。本文將介紹如何使用 Python 來將圖片轉換為灰階。
什麼是灰階圖片?
灰階圖片是一種單色圖片,它只有黑色和白色,沒有其他顏色。它的像素值介於 0 到 255 之間,0 表示完全黑色,255 表示完全白色,而中間的值則表示不同程度的灰色。
使用 Python 將圖片轉換為灰階
Python 提供了一個叫做 Pillow 的函式庫,可以用於處理圖片。我們可以使用它來將圖片轉換為灰階。
首先,我們需要安裝 Pillow 函式庫:
pip install Pillow
接下來,我們可以使用以下程式碼將圖片轉換為灰階:
from PIL import Image
# 讀取圖片
img = Image.open('image.jpg')
# 將圖片轉換為灰階
img = img.convert('L')
# 儲存圖片
img.save('image_gray.jpg')
上面的程式碼首先會讀取一個圖片,然後將它轉換為灰階,最後儲存轉換後的圖片。
如何使用 Pillow 將圖片轉換為灰階?
Pillow 提供了一個叫做 convert() 的函式,可以用於將圖片轉換為灰階。它接受一個參數,用於指定要轉換的顏色模式。
在這裡,我們使用 ‘L’ 作為參數,它表示要將圖片轉換為灰階。
總結
本文介紹了如何使用 Python 將圖片轉換為灰階。我們可以使用 Pillow 函式庫的 convert() 函式來將圖片轉換為灰階,並指定 ‘L’ 作為參數。
推薦閱讀文章
Python PIL Image – Convert Method
Python Pillow Library – Image Processing
Python Pillow – Converting an Image to Grayscale
Convert Image to Grayscale using Python
4 Point OpenCV getPerspective Transform Example</a